diff options
author | Renato Botelho <garga@FreeBSD.org> | 2011-12-28 15:25:09 +0000 |
---|---|---|
committer | Renato Botelho <garga@FreeBSD.org> | 2011-12-28 15:25:09 +0000 |
commit | ae7a68c230f5bac35072a5464e9c295d1936376f (patch) | |
tree | c6c53c98b80a5cb5325a9f91846820d5721b3be9 /net/xmlrpc-c-devel | |
parent | 3aa4dd53ea1632e08830d2aa437889597a2fdd68 (diff) | |
download | ports-ae7a68c230f5bac35072a5464e9c295d1936376f.tar.gz ports-ae7a68c230f5bac35072a5464e9c295d1936376f.zip |
Notes
Diffstat (limited to 'net/xmlrpc-c-devel')
-rw-r--r-- | net/xmlrpc-c-devel/Makefile | 2 | ||||
-rw-r--r-- | net/xmlrpc-c-devel/distinfo | 4 | ||||
-rw-r--r-- | net/xmlrpc-c-devel/files/patch-include__xmlrpc-c__base.hpp | 76 | ||||
-rw-r--r-- | net/xmlrpc-c-devel/pkg-plist | 34 |
4 files changed, 20 insertions, 96 deletions
diff --git a/net/xmlrpc-c-devel/Makefile b/net/xmlrpc-c-devel/Makefile index c538de14187e..34b88e552360 100644 --- a/net/xmlrpc-c-devel/Makefile +++ b/net/xmlrpc-c-devel/Makefile @@ -7,7 +7,7 @@ # PORTNAME= xmlrpc-c -PORTVERSION= 1.27.1 +PORTVERSION= 1.28.4 CATEGORIES= net MASTER_SITES= LOCAL/garga/xmlrpc-c PKGNAMESUFFIX= -devel diff --git a/net/xmlrpc-c-devel/distinfo b/net/xmlrpc-c-devel/distinfo index a43c7ff54966..f81bfeed81b6 100644 --- a/net/xmlrpc-c-devel/distinfo +++ b/net/xmlrpc-c-devel/distinfo @@ -1,2 +1,2 @@ -SHA256 (xmlrpc-c-1.27.1.tar.bz2) = cadc73c709160ac6d97e50e84795051285f0c9c0251c945d325b5fa9e84ed9c4 -SIZE (xmlrpc-c-1.27.1.tar.bz2) = 597252 +SHA256 (xmlrpc-c-1.28.4.tar.bz2) = dc72993239bf9942272ad82bb6ba291b4336e7445ebba1a18938207c0ef781e5 +SIZE (xmlrpc-c-1.28.4.tar.bz2) = 605212 diff --git a/net/xmlrpc-c-devel/files/patch-include__xmlrpc-c__base.hpp b/net/xmlrpc-c-devel/files/patch-include__xmlrpc-c__base.hpp deleted file mode 100644 index 3744db6d0290..000000000000 --- a/net/xmlrpc-c-devel/files/patch-include__xmlrpc-c__base.hpp +++ /dev/null @@ -1,76 +0,0 @@ ---- include/xmlrpc-c/base.hpp.orig 2011-07-26 14:56:50.000000000 -0300 -+++ include/xmlrpc-c/base.hpp 2011-07-27 09:46:38.000000000 -0300 -@@ -226,28 +226,6 @@ - - - --template<class InputIterator> xmlrpc_c::value_array --arrayValueSlice(InputIterator begin, -- InputIterator end) { --/*---------------------------------------------------------------------------- -- convert C++ iterator pair to XML-RPC array -------------------------------------------------------------------------------*/ -- carray ret; -- for (InputIterator p = begin; p != end; ++p) { -- ret.push_back(toValue(*p)); -- } -- return xmlrpc_c::value_array(ret); --} -- --template<class MemberClass> inline xmlrpc_c::value_array --arrayValueArray(const MemberClass * const in, -- size_t const size) { --/*---------------------------------------------------------------------------- -- convert C++ array to XML-RPC array -------------------------------------------------------------------------------*/ -- return arrayValueSlice(in, in + size); --} -- - class XMLRPC_DLLEXPORT value_nil : public value { - public: - value_nil(); -@@ -296,7 +274,7 @@ - } - - inline xmlrpc_c::value_bytestring -- toValue(cbytestring const& x) { -+toValue(cbytestring const& x) { - return xmlrpc_c::value_bytestring(x); - } - -@@ -324,6 +302,19 @@ - return xmlrpc_c::value_struct(ret); - } - -+template<class InputIterator> xmlrpc_c::value_array -+arrayValueSlice(InputIterator begin, -+ InputIterator end) { -+/*---------------------------------------------------------------------------- -+ convert C++ iterator pair to XML-RPC array -+-----------------------------------------------------------------------------*/ -+ carray ret; -+ for (InputIterator p = begin; p != end; ++p) { -+ ret.push_back(toValue(*p)); -+ } -+ return xmlrpc_c::value_array(ret); -+} -+ - template<class T> inline xmlrpc_c::value_array - toValue(std::vector<T> const& in) { - /*---------------------------------------------------------------------------- -@@ -398,6 +389,15 @@ - } - } - -+template<class MemberClass> inline xmlrpc_c::value_array -+arrayValueArray(const MemberClass * const in, -+ size_t const size) { -+/*---------------------------------------------------------------------------- -+ convert C++ array to XML-RPC array -+-----------------------------------------------------------------------------*/ -+ return arrayValueSlice(in, in + size); -+} -+ - class XMLRPC_DLLEXPORT fault { - /*---------------------------------------------------------------------------- - This is an XML-RPC fault. diff --git a/net/xmlrpc-c-devel/pkg-plist b/net/xmlrpc-c-devel/pkg-plist index e6f3b852c24a..03244e446ebc 100644 --- a/net/xmlrpc-c-devel/pkg-plist +++ b/net/xmlrpc-c-devel/pkg-plist @@ -45,69 +45,69 @@ include/xmlrpc_server_w32httpsys.h lib/libxmlrpc++.a lib/libxmlrpc++.so lib/libxmlrpc++.so.7 -lib/libxmlrpc++.so.7.27 +lib/libxmlrpc++.so.7.28 lib/libxmlrpc.a lib/libxmlrpc.so lib/libxmlrpc.so.3 -lib/libxmlrpc.so.3.27 +lib/libxmlrpc.so.3.28 lib/libxmlrpc_abyss.a lib/libxmlrpc_abyss.so lib/libxmlrpc_abyss.so.3 -lib/libxmlrpc_abyss.so.3.27 +lib/libxmlrpc_abyss.so.3.28 %%CLIENT%%lib/libxmlrpc_client++.a %%CLIENT%%lib/libxmlrpc_client++.so %%CLIENT%%lib/libxmlrpc_client++.so.7 -%%CLIENT%%lib/libxmlrpc_client++.so.7.27 +%%CLIENT%%lib/libxmlrpc_client++.so.7.28 %%CLIENT%%lib/libxmlrpc_client.a %%CLIENT%%lib/libxmlrpc_client.so %%CLIENT%%lib/libxmlrpc_client.so.3 -%%CLIENT%%lib/libxmlrpc_client.so.3.27 +%%CLIENT%%lib/libxmlrpc_client.so.3.28 lib/libxmlrpc_cpp.a lib/libxmlrpc_cpp.so lib/libxmlrpc_cpp.so.7 -lib/libxmlrpc_cpp.so.7.27 +lib/libxmlrpc_cpp.so.7.28 lib/libxmlrpc_packetsocket.a lib/libxmlrpc_packetsocket.so lib/libxmlrpc_packetsocket.so.7 -lib/libxmlrpc_packetsocket.so.7.27 +lib/libxmlrpc_packetsocket.so.7.28 lib/libxmlrpc_server++.a lib/libxmlrpc_server++.so lib/libxmlrpc_server++.so.7 -lib/libxmlrpc_server++.so.7.27 +lib/libxmlrpc_server++.so.7.28 lib/libxmlrpc_server.a lib/libxmlrpc_server.so lib/libxmlrpc_server.so.3 -lib/libxmlrpc_server.so.3.27 +lib/libxmlrpc_server.so.3.28 lib/libxmlrpc_server_abyss++.a lib/libxmlrpc_server_abyss++.so lib/libxmlrpc_server_abyss++.so.7 -lib/libxmlrpc_server_abyss++.so.7.27 +lib/libxmlrpc_server_abyss++.so.7.28 lib/libxmlrpc_server_abyss.a lib/libxmlrpc_server_abyss.so lib/libxmlrpc_server_abyss.so.3 -lib/libxmlrpc_server_abyss.so.3.27 +lib/libxmlrpc_server_abyss.so.3.28 lib/libxmlrpc_server_cgi++.a lib/libxmlrpc_server_cgi++.so lib/libxmlrpc_server_cgi++.so.7 -lib/libxmlrpc_server_cgi++.so.7.27 +lib/libxmlrpc_server_cgi++.so.7.28 lib/libxmlrpc_server_cgi.a lib/libxmlrpc_server_cgi.so lib/libxmlrpc_server_cgi.so.3 -lib/libxmlrpc_server_cgi.so.3.27 +lib/libxmlrpc_server_cgi.so.3.28 lib/libxmlrpc_server_pstream++.a lib/libxmlrpc_server_pstream++.so lib/libxmlrpc_server_pstream++.so.7 -lib/libxmlrpc_server_pstream++.so.7.27 +lib/libxmlrpc_server_pstream++.so.7.28 lib/libxmlrpc_util.a lib/libxmlrpc_util.so lib/libxmlrpc_util.so.3 -lib/libxmlrpc_util.so.3.27 +lib/libxmlrpc_util.so.3.28 lib/libxmlrpc_xmlparse.a lib/libxmlrpc_xmlparse.so lib/libxmlrpc_xmlparse.so.3 -lib/libxmlrpc_xmlparse.so.3.27 +lib/libxmlrpc_xmlparse.so.3.28 lib/libxmlrpc_xmltok.a lib/libxmlrpc_xmltok.so lib/libxmlrpc_xmltok.so.3 -lib/libxmlrpc_xmltok.so.3.27 +lib/libxmlrpc_xmltok.so.3.28 @dirrm include/xmlrpc-c |